I had a run in the snow this morning. This car is incredible of efficiency.
Panda has a good handling and nothing seems to stop it in these conditions.
You don't really feel something in the system when the rear wheels start to work. It is discreet.
Mine has been delivered with snow tires so this might improve a little bit the handling but anyway, it is very safe in low adherence conditions.
